What’s a lesson you had to unlearn and what’s the backstory?
The lesson I needed to unlearn was about my self-worth- I grew up in a narcissistic family and was able to unlearn and heal the pattern of having low self worth and low self-esteem, what most people don’t realize is this starts at home and when you are young.
If you do not have people in your life from a young age who tell you and show you love and care for yourself – you are constantly trying to receive approval or validation from outside sources. So, I had to re-parent myself and my brain to realize how talented, intelligent and lovable I am, in order to fulfill my calling in life.
I’ve been through platonic and romantic situations where I didn’t always know my worth, and until I really took a look at how I was giving to situations that really didn’t deserve my attention, I felt that was how life was going to be for me- a never-ending cycle of abusive and bad relationships and bad habits that I couldn’t escape, until I found peace with who I am regardless of what others thought of me.

Can you tell us about a time you’ve had to pivot?
Over the last 4 years I had to pivot in life after a breast cancer diagnosis and losing my job due to Covid and ending up homeless with my children. I had been a social worker for the past 20 years completing duties for government funded companies and was never satisfied with the outcomes for my clients, most of the jobs were in hospitals, or agencies where I was able to travel and make sure my clients were receiving the services in-home or in their nursing home where they resided.
When Covid hit- I loss my mother to it, my place of residence and my job. After healing from my breast cancer surgery (while homeless with 2 of my 4 children), I stayed in a shelter for families by the name of Sarah’s Hope, while in the shelter as.a social worker, you see all the people who would be your clients, as a client, I was able to see the places where we lack as social service workers to make sure our clients receive the necessary resources to be able to afford housing and maintain basic life sustaining elements. In this particular shelter, I noticed the trauma from the different single mothers, fathers and children who interacted with me and realized this is keeps families and survivors of trauma in a cycle of repetitive homelessness and bad health-it was the unhealed trauma over the years that has been overlooked by service workers, just ready to see the services and resources that we need instead of really taking a look at the trauma which has landed the individual in the same circumstances repeatedly, I know this because I also went through this.
With this God given epiphany, I founded the non-profit – Blossom & Grow, LLC where we encourage everyone to “Grow Through What they Go Through”- we currently host a podcast “Social Seeds” where we speak to individuals about their healing journey and where we also give resources and activities on how to heal thyself through holistic means and therapeutic practices including one on one therapy.
I also founded- The Awakened Empress 33, LLC- which is another one of my businesses, where I have a growing following on Tiktok & YouTube- where I introduce spiritual guidance and energy readings/healing, meditation and breathe-work for a balanced and grounded life.
They seem to be growing at a steady pace and I am hoping in the years to come to build a holistic center where survivors of trauma and their families can come to receive educational classes, therapy and nutritional education on how to balance our mind, bodies and souls in order to live a more balanced life and fulfilled life.
